2023: Atiku is the best Candidate – Tambuwal

Sokoto State governor and Director General of PDP Presidential Campaign Council, Hon. Aminu Tambuwal on Wednesday told voters in Ogun state that Atiku Abubakar is the only Presidential Candidate with capacity to deliver on his mandate.

Tambuwal argued that Atiku is the only candidate who has occupied executive office at the national level, deeply involved in the private sector management and has a clear master plan on how to execute his campaign promises.

Tambuwal made the case on Wednesday in Abuja when the party’s Presidential train landed in Abeokuta, Ogun state capital.

The former Speaker of House of Representative, said that Tambuwal has perfected plans to devolve more powers to the state, create jobs for the youths and women.

“Atiku is the only candidate that has identified restructuring and proffered ways and means through which he is going to restructure Nigeria. There will be more powers to the state, there will be more powers to local government, there will be more resources, there will be more devolution of powers and devolution of resources for the development of our country.

“When you elect Atiku Abubakar, you are sure that you have a CEO that will drive your interest and engender good governance in Nigeria. The others, I believe, you cannot trust them. They don’t have the type of experience that Atiku Abubakar is having, of governance at the federal level. He is the most prepared of the candidates”.

Addressing the crowd, PDP Presidential Candidate, Atiku Abubakar said that he will make the exploitation of the mineral deposit in the country, his top priority.

“We have promised to devolved more powers to Ogun state and to the local governments in Ogun. We have promised to ensure the industrialization of Ogun state because Ogun state is endowed with so many mineral resources and in order to create jobs and prosperity, the federal government under the PDP government will make sure that the exploitation of those mineral resources and industrialization of Ogun is made a priority.

“We want to appeal to you to come out and vote and make sure that your votes are counted and also protect your vote. The APC government has failed us and therefore, it is our responsibility to make sure that we don’t return them to power”.

The National Chairman of the Party, Sen. Iyrochia Ayu in his address said that the ruling party are already jittery and have resorted to denying PDP use of government facilities for campaigns.

Ayu boasted that despite all the denials, the ruling party will be crushed at the polls come February 25.

“We will crush them at the polling booth, we will crush them at the ward, we will crush them at the local government and we will crush them nationally. We must recover this country; we must rebuild Nigeria because we want a better living condition for our people.

“We know you are suffering, many of you can’t even eat in your houses, life is unbearable for you, you can’t even find fuel.

“I want to assure you that when Atiku Abubakar comes back to power, life will return better to those days that the PDP were able to create”.

Present at the campaign arena were Chairman of PDP Campaign Council, Gov. Udom Emmanuel and his Osun State counterpart Sen. Ademola Adeleke, BoT Chairman Sen. Adolphus Wabara, former Senate President Bukola Saraki, former Speaker of the House of Representative Yakubu Dogara and many party stalwarts.
